270 Ah 12.8 V LiFePO₄ (≈ 3.46 kWh) using UL-listed cylindrical cells. Safe, non-toxic chemistry with 100% usable capacity, high efficiency (99%), and no memory effect.
3,000 – 5,000 deep discharge cycles (@ 80–100% DoD). Expected lifespan of 10 to 15 years in RV, marine, and off-grid applications.
Proprietary Battery Management System (BMS) manages cell balancing, over/under voltage, current, temperature, and short circuit protection. Automatic fault reset in ≈ 5 seconds.
GC3 form factor supports any orientation. Mount in series (≤ 48 V) or parallel (unlimited). Use same state of charge and temperature before linking. A Current Surge Limiter (CSL) is required for inverters ≥ 3500 W.
10-year warranty. Designed and assembled in the USA to meet UL 1642, UN38.3, and IP65 standards. Technical support available via Battle Born Batteries (855-292-2831 | info@battlebornbatteries.com).
The BBGC3iH delivers 3.46 kWh of dependable LiFePO₄ power with an integrated heater and a smart BMS featuring Dragonfly IntelLigence® for Bluetooth® monitoring and wireless mesh networking. Built for RV, marine, off-grid, and mobile power systems that need reliable performance in Canadian climates.
Specification | Details |
---|---|
Battery Type | Lithium Iron Phosphate (LiFePO₄), UL-listed cylindrical cells |
Nominal Voltage | 12.8 V |
Capacity / Energy | 270 Ah (≈ 3.46 kWh) |
Cycle Life | 3,000–5,000 deep cycles (@ 80–100% DoD) |
Usable Depth of Discharge | 100% |
Internal Resistance | ≈ 5 mΩ |
Self-Discharge | ≈ 2–3% per month |
Maximum Series Voltage | 48 V (series up to 4 batteries); unlimited parallel |
Charging (Absorption / Float) | 14.2–14.6 V / 13.4–13.8 V |
Recommended / Max Charge Current | ≤ 135 A (0.5C) / 135 A |
Continuous Discharge Current | 300 A |
Peak / Surge Discharge | 500 A (30 s) | > 500 A (0.5 s) |
Integrated Heating (iH) | Heat-enable terminal; activates around ~1.7 °C (35 °F) when enabled; ≈ 28 W draw |
Operating Temperatures | Discharge: −20 °C to +57 °C (−4 °F to 135 °F) • Charge (heat-enabled): down to ~−4 °C (25 °F) up to 135 °F |
Smart BMS / Communications | Dragonfly IntelLigence®: Bluetooth® + wireless mesh; Battle Born App (iOS); HUB required for multi-battery/advanced features |
Case / Ingress Protection | ABS, fire-rated • IP65 water-resistant (non-submersible) |
Terminals & Hardware | 0.25″ brass flag terminals, 3/8″ hole (use 3/8″ or 5/16″ hardware); torque 9–11 ft-lb (≈ 108–132 in-lb / 12 N·m) |
Dimensions (L × W × H) | 58.0 × 18.0 × 33.4 cm (22.83″ × 7.09″ × 13.15″) |
Weight | ≈ 36.7 kg (80.8 lb) |
Included Hardware | Finishing hardware kit: (2) 5/16-18 × 1″ bolts, (2) 5/16-18 × 1-1/4″ bolts, (4) washers, (2) Nylok nuts |
Certifications | UL 1642 (cells), UN38.3, UL 121201 / CSA C22.2 No.213-17 (C1D2), IP65 |
Applications | Off-Grid Solar, RVs & Motorhomes, Marine, Cabins, Mobile/Industrial Power |
Warranty | 10-Year Manufacturer Warranty (Battle Born Batteries / Dragonfly Energy) |
Note: A Current Surge Limiter (CSL) is required when using inverters rated at 3,500 W or higher.
While lead-acid batteries are ideal for vehicle ignition, lithium-ion batteries are the top choice for RVers needing versatile energy storage. Lithium-ion batteries efficiently power a wide range of amenities—from keeping food fresh to supporting work on the road—making them an indispensable part of modern RV travel.
Lead-acid batteries have the advantage of being well-established and reliable. They are generally less expensive upfront, making them an attractive option for budget-conscious consumers. Additionally, they are widely available, ensuring that you can easily find a replacement while on the road.
However, lead-acid batteries tend to be heavier and bulkier, which can be a concern in an RV where space is limited. They also require more frequent maintenance, such as topping off with distilled water, and have a lower energy density compared to lithium-ion batteries.
Lithium-ion batteries are lighter and more compact, allowing you to make better use of the limited space in an RV. They also have a higher energy density, enabling them to store more power without increasing their size. Plus, they generally require little to no maintenance.
The main drawback of lithium-ion batteries is their higher upfront cost. However, this can often be offset by their longer lifespan and greater energy efficiency, especially for RVers who spend a lot of time on the road.

The BBGC3iH includes an integrated heater that allows safe charging in sub-freezing conditions. When the heat-enable terminal is switched on, heating engages automatically around ~1.7 °C (35 °F). Power draw is ~28 W while heating.
Temps: Charge (heat-enabled) down to ~−4 °C/25 °F; Discharge −20 °C to +57 °C (−4 °F to 135 °F).

Yes. Wire in series up to 48 V (4 batteries) and unlimited in parallel. For heated systems, link the heat-enable leads (or use a single switch) so all batteries heat evenly. Ensure batteries have similar state of charge and temperature before linking.
Yes. The iH model includes a Smart BMS (cell balancing, over/under-voltage, over-current, short-circuit, high/low temp cutoffs) and Dragonfly IntelLigence® communications for Bluetooth® monitoring and a wireless mesh network.
Use the Battle Born App (iOS) for SoC, voltage, temperature, history, and alerts (updates ~every 5 s). A Battle Born Hub is required for multi-battery and advanced features (e.g., RV-C/NMEA 2000 integration).

Store in a cool, dry place. Bring to 100% charge and disconnect from loads; typical self-discharge is ~2–3%/month. After ~6 months, recharge if needed. Storage temperature range: −10 °F to 140 °F (−23 °C to 60 °C).
Mount in any orientation. Torque terminals to 9–11 ft-lb (≈ 12 N·m). Use properly sized cables/fusing. CSL required with inverters ≥ 3,500 W.
